Digital Wallets: The Future of Online Transactions
As the online marketplace continues to expand, digital wallets are rapidly emerging as the preferred method for executing transactions. These protected platforms offer a seamless way to store payment information, minimizing the need for physical tools. Consumers can now swiftly make purchases with just a few taps, providing a efficient shopping experience. Furthermore, digital wallets often integrate with various rewards schemes, offering additional perks to users. With their flexibility, security features, and user-centric design, digital wallets are poised to transform the future of online transactions.

One of the most commonly accepted methods is credit/debit cards. These provide a protected way to process purchases online. Alternatively, digital wallets like copyright and Apple Pay offer a faster and convenient payment experience. They allow you to store your payment details securely, excluding the need to provide them repeatedly.
- Furthermore, there are diverse online payment apps that link directly with your bank account, offering a protected and touchless payment option.
Apart from these traditional methods, copyright is increasing in popularity as an online payment option. While it may still be relatively recent, copyright offers a independent and protected way to conduct transactions.
